Subject: Kestrelware Divestiture — Heads Up

Hi all,

Quick update for finance: the sale of the Kestrelware tooling unit to Bramblefield Holdings is moving faster than expected. Diligence wraps next week, and Mira's team is finalising the working-capital adjustments now. Please hold any reclassifications on that ledger until close. Expect a proper walkthrough at Thursday's sync. Before then, please review the note below.

internal memo for kawip-hadug: Headcount on the Wenwyn team goes from 7 to 140 by the end of January. Gross margin on Wenwyn came in at 20 percent against a plan of 15 percent.

## Crashfunnel 2.4 — Default changes

Defaults changed in the crash-report pipeline. Symbolication now retries twice, not five times. Reports older than 30 days auto-purge (was 90). Duplicate grouping threshold tightened; expect fewer but larger clusters in the support console. Minidumps over 25 MB are dropped with a warning instead of queued. No support-side action required, but ticket links to purged reports will 404. Current production defaults are listed below.

config for kajog-tadug:
[casax]
port = 11211
region = west-3
host = casax.nelvroworks.internal
timeout_ms = 5000
retries = 7

## Key Ceremony Checklist — Item 7: Relevance Tuning Notes

Security reviewer: confirm the Quillmark search relevance tuning notes are excluded from the ceremony artifact bundle. These notes reference internal ranking signals and must not be sealed with the public key material. Verify the manifest hash matches the pre-ceremony snapshot, confirm no tuning files appear in the archive listing, and initial the witness log. After both initials are recorded, proceed to vault sealing, which requires the recovery passphrase listed immediately below.

unlock words, hahip-baduf: holwyn-istath-julvan